内容简介
  The software industry moves unrelentingly toward new methods for managing the ever-increasing complexity of software projects. In the past, we have seen evolu- tions, revolutions, and recurring themes of success and failure. While software technol-ogies, processes, and methods have advanced rapidly, software engineering remains apeople-intensive process. Consequently, techniques for managing people, technologyresources, and risks have profound leverage.
作者简介
  作者WalkerRoyce是Rational软件公司副总裁兼总经理,曾任软件设计师、集成工程师、成本估算师、软件体系培训教师、研发部主任、产品经理、项目经理等多项有关项目管理的工作,并且积极从事软件项目管理的研究工作,形成了自己的一套完整的思想。
